Nestled in the vibrant city of Port of Spain, Whitehall stands as a testament to Trinidad and Tobago's rich colonial history. This historic site, characterized by its stunning architecture and lush gardens, was once the residence of prominent figures, allowing visitors to step back in time and immerse themselves in the stories of the nation’s past. The estate is a splendid example of colonial design, featuring intricate wooden details and expansive verandas that overlook the beautifully landscaped grounds. As you wander through the estate, you will encounter informative displays that narrate the history of the property and its significance to the local culture. The gardens, well-kept and serene, offer a peaceful retreat from the bustling city, making it an ideal spot for relaxation and reflection. Visitors are encouraged to explore the various nooks and crannies of the estate, where hidden gems await discovery. Beyond its visual appeal, Whitehall serves as a cultural hub, occasionally hosting events that showcase local art and music, further enriching the visitor experience.
